diff options
author | 53hornet <53hornet@gmail.com> | 2019-04-04 17:05:43 -0400 |
---|---|---|
committer | 53hornet <53hornet@gmail.com> | 2019-04-04 17:05:43 -0400 |
commit | a187a89bc60994f9bd58b6c31f6f3f4275bcb195 (patch) | |
tree | ea47686df4e8f49df0cce5d2e2719a9f4a3622b7 /_layouts | |
parent | 5a67f495b72f1bdbfbe5dbb770b9d25cc2f16055 (diff) | |
download | cobalt-site-a187a89bc60994f9bd58b6c31f6f3f4275bcb195.tar.xz cobalt-site-a187a89bc60994f9bd58b6c31f6f3f4275bcb195.zip |
Finished index layout, page layout; split out common includes.
Diffstat (limited to '_layouts')
-rw-r--r-- | _layouts/index.liquid | 135 | ||||
-rw-r--r-- | _layouts/page.liquid | 146 |
2 files changed, 36 insertions, 245 deletions
diff --git a/_layouts/index.liquid b/_layouts/index.liquid index 5e65fbf..20ec588 100644 --- a/_layouts/index.liquid +++ b/_layouts/index.liquid @@ -4,6 +4,7 @@ <meta charset="utf-8"> <title>{{ page.title }}</title> <link rel="stylesheet" href="bulma.css"> + <link rel="stylesheet" href="animate.css"> </head> <body> @@ -16,116 +17,24 @@ "> <!-- begin hero head --> <div class="hero-head"> - <div class="container"> - - <!-- begin navbar --> - <nav class="navbar animated fadeInDown"> - <!-- begin brand --> - <div class="navbar-brand"> - <a class="navbar-item" href="/"> - <img src="logo.png"> - </a> - </div> - <!-- end brand --> - - <!-- begin menu --> - <div class="navbar-menu is-active"> - - <!-- begin start --> - <div class="navbar-start"> - <a class="navbar-item"> - YouTube - </a> - - <a class="navbar-item"> - GitLab - </a> - - <a class="navbar-item"> - LinkedIn - </a> - - </div> - <!-- end start --> - - <!-- begin end --> - <div class="navbar-end"> - <a class="navbar-item"> - Subscribe to RSS Feed - </a> - </div> - <!-- end end --> - - </div> - <!-- end menu --> - - </nav> - <!-- end navbar --> - - </div> + {% include "nav.liquid" %} </div> - <!-- end hero header --> + <!-- end hero head --> <!-- begin hero body --> <div class="hero-body"> <div class="container"> - <div class="columns"> - - <!-- begin content --> - <div class="column"> - <h1 class="title is-1"> - {{ page.title }} - </h1> - </div> - <!-- end content --> - - <!-- begin TOC --> - <div class=" - column - is-narrow - animated - fadeInRight - "> - <div class="box"> - <aside class="menu"> - <p class="menu-label"> - Automotive - </p> - <ul class="menu-list"> - <li> - {% for post in collections.posts.pages %} - <a href="{{ post.permalink }}"> - {{ post.title }} - </a> - {% endfor %} -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- <a>test</a> - </li> - </ul> - <p class="menu-label"> - Technology - </p> - <p class="menu-label"> - Life - </p> - </aside> - </div> - </div> - <!-- end TOC --> + <!-- begin content --> + <div class="column"> + <h1 class="title"> + {{ page.title }} + </h1> + {{ page.content }} </div> + <!-- end content --> + </div> </div> <!-- end hero body --> @@ -133,27 +42,7 @@ </section> <!-- end hero --> - <!-- begin footer --> - <footer class="footer"> - <div class="content has-text-centered"> - <p> - This static site was built using Cobalt.rs, Bulma.io, - Animate.css, and is self-hosted with Nginx - </p> - <p> - See a problem? - <a href="#"> - Tell me so I can fix it - </a> - or - <a href="#"> - fix it yourself! - </a> - </p> - </div> - </footer> - <!-- end footer --> - + {% include "footer.liquid" %} </body> </html> diff --git a/_layouts/page.liquid b/_layouts/page.liquid index 7dc01b7..3d5e1ef 100644 --- a/_layouts/page.liquid +++ b/_layouts/page.liquid @@ -9,145 +9,47 @@ <body> <!-- begin hero --> <section class=" - hero - is-primary - is-fullheight - "> + hero + is-primary + "> <!-- begin hero head --> <div class="hero-head"> - <div class="container"> - - <!-- begin navbar --> - <nav class="navbar animated fadeInDown"> - <!-- begin brand --> - <div class="navbar-brand"> - <a class="navbar-item" href="/"> - <img src="logo.png"> - </a> - </div> - <!-- end brand --> - - <!-- begin menu --> - <div class="navbar-menu is-active"> - - <!-- begin start --> - <div class="navbar-start"> - <a class="navbar-item"> - Home - </a> - <a class="navbar-item"> - '53 Hornet - </a> - <a class="navbar-item"> - Technology - </a> - </div> - <!-- end start --> - - <!-- begin end --> - <div class="navbar-end"> - <a class="navbar-item"> - About - </a> - </div> - <!-- end end --> - - </div> - <!-- end menu --> - - </nav> - <!-- end navbar --> - - </div> + {% include "nav.liquid" %} </div> - <!-- end hero header --> + <!-- end hero head --> <!-- begin hero body --> <div class="hero-body"> <div class="container"> - <h2 class="title"> + <h1 class="title"> {{ page.title }} - </h2> - - {{ page.content }} + </h1> </div> </div> <!-- end hero body --> - <!-- begin hero footer --> - <div class=" - hero-foot - animated - fadeInUp - "> - <div class=" - container - has-text-centered - "> - <div class=" - buttons - has-addons - is-centered - "> - <a class=" - button - is-rounded - is-light - is-outlined - "> - <span> - Facebook - </span> - </a> - <a class=" - button - is-rounded - is-light - is-outlined - "> - <span> - LinkedIn - </span> - </a> - <a class=" - button - is-rounded - is-light - is-outlined - "> - <span> - RSS - </span> - </a> - </div> - </div> - </div> - <!-- end hero footer --> - </section> <!-- end hero --> - <!-- begin footer --> - <footer class="footer"> - <div class="content has-text-centered"> - <p> - This static site was built using Cobalt.rs, Bulma.io, - Animate.css, and is self-hosted with Nginx - </p> - <p> - See a problem? - <a href="#"> - Tell me so I can fix it - </a> - or - <a href="#"> - fix it yourself! - </a> - </p> + <!-- begin main content --> + <section class="section"> + <div class="container"> + <div class="columns"> + + <div class="column"> + {{ page.content }} + </div> + + <div class="column is-narrow"> + {% include "toc.liquid" %} + </div> + + </div> </div> - </footer> - <!-- end footer --> + </section> + <!-- end main content --> + {% include "footer.liquid" %} </body> </html> |